adverbs are always spelled with an -ly suffix ture or false

Respuesta :

Sarah06109
Sarah06109 Sarah06109
  • 16-04-2020

Answer:

False

Explanation:

Adverbs usually describe verbs, or other adverbs and adjectives. They usually answer the "how, where, when, how much and how often."

While many adverbs do end in ly, there are also many that do not.

Some examples include: tomorrow, low, soon, how, often, far, already, even.
